Job Summary
The Electronic Technician is respon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, repairing, and installing a wide range of electronic and control systems used in oilfield operations. This role ensures high levels of equipment reliability and safety and supports production, drilling, or maintenance operations across industrial assets.
Experience:
- Typically 3+ years of relevant work experience in electronics maintenance, preferably within the oil & gas, energy, or industrial sector. Gulf or Middle East experience preferred.
- Strong practical skills in troubleshooting electronic systems, control panels, and PLC/instrumentation equipment.
- Proficiency reading and interpreting elect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and technical documents.
- Good communication skills and the ability to work effectively within a multidisciplinary team.
